Saturday, November 14th, from 6 to 8 pm
Unitarian Universalist Church of Indianapolis,
615 W. 43rd St., Indianapolis, 46208
This year's observance of the Transgender Day of Remembrance will feature a live performance of the short play "TransActions," directed by Jeffrey Barnes; a moderated panel discussion of the play and issues facing the trans community; a memorial vigil; and refreshments and fellowship until 9 pm.
This event has been held nationally since 1999 to bring community-wide awareness to the terrible consequences of transphobia.
